First look of Chandhunadh-starrer Cyber out

Billed as a techno-thriller, the film delves into modern technology and its darker side

The makers of Cyber, starring Chandhunadh, unveiled its first look poster on Sunday. The upcoming film, also featuring Prasanth Murali, Jeeva, and Cereena Ann in lead roles, carries the tagline, 'The Lord Will Avenge His People – Gila: Chapter 1.' The poster shows three figures on a hill, overlooking a burning, futuristic city.

Billed as a techno-thriller, Cyber delves into modern technology and its darker side. Directed by Manu Krishna, the film is produced by G K Pillai and Santha G Pillai under the KGlobal Films banner in association with Root Production. On the technical front, Manu also serves as its music director, with Vishnu Mahadev as editor, and Pramod K Pillai and Yurii Kryvoshei as cinematographers.

Chandhunadh will next appear in Thrayam, starring Dhyan Sreenivasan and Anarkali Marikar, set for release on October 25. The Pathinettam Padi actor is also part of Jeethu Joseph’s Ram, headlined by Mohanlal and Trisha, and Manoj Vasudev’s Khjuraho Dreams, alongside Arjun Ashokan and Sreenath Bhasi.
